The lights are low.\u003cbr\u003eWe’re basking in a newborn glow.\u003cbr\u003e\u003cbr\u003eInside the cozy house, a baby has arrived! The world is eager to meet the newcomer, but there will be time enough for that later. Right now, the family is on its babymoon: cocooning, connecting, learning, and muddling through each new concern. While the term “babymoon” is often used to refer to a parents’ getaway before the birth of a child, it was originally coined by midwives to describe days like these: at home with a newborn, with the world held at bay and the wonder of a new family constellation unfolding. Paired with warm and winsome illustrations by Juana Martinez-Neal, Hayley Barrett’s lyrical ode to these tender first days will resonate with new families everywhere. A loving couple bring home their new baby and spend their first day(s) together reveling in their love and their new life as they get to know each other. The lyrical text works perfectly in rhyme and meter to create a soothing image of the newness of a first-time family experience. The gentle cadence invites reading aloud at bedtime or in a storytime, but the real draw here are Martinez-Neal's illustrations. They are done in acrylic, colored pencil, and graphite and have a glowing softness to them. The mom is all rounded edges, with medium brown skin and lushly flowing dark hair. Dad and baby have a slightly lighter complexion and are equally appealing. The backgrounds are spare, keeping the focus on the family and their facial expressions, which glow with love. Each parent gets a page to themselves with baby, the mom's spread depicting her gazing lovingly down at her nursing infant. The book draws the viewer into this cozy world of newness and love. While the text is likely to speak more to the parents than the children, the flowing language will work well to soothe both baby and parent. She lives in eastern Massachusetts.\u003cbr\u003e\u003cbr\u003eJuana Martinez-Nealis the Peruvian-born daughter and granddaughter of painters. Her debut as an author-illustrator,Alma and How She Got Her Name, was awarded a Caldecott Honor and was published in Spanish asAlma y cómo obtuvo su nombre. She also illustratedLa Princesa and the Peaby Susan Middleton Elya, for which she won a Pura Belpré Illustrator Award,Babymoonby Hayley Barrett, Swashby and the Sea by Beth Ferry, andFry Bread: A Native American Family Storyby Kevin Noble Maillard, which won a Robert F.
